The Power of Localized Content

While brands often strive for a global presence, the true impact of their marketing efforts hinges on the power of localized content.

By embracing localized messaging, companies can enhance cultural relevance, resonating with diverse audiences.

This approach not only fosters deeper connections but also drives engagement and loyalty, ultimately leading to improved market performance in various regions and empowering consumers through relatable experiences.

Leveraging Digital Platforms for Global Reach

How can brands effectively harness the power of digital platforms to extend their global reach?

By utilizing social media and targeted advertising, companies can engage diverse audiences and stimulate brand awareness.

These platforms facilitate real-time interaction, enabling brands to respond to local preferences and trends.

Ultimately, a strategic digital presence fosters connections that transcend geographical boundaries, driving growth and enhancing brand loyalty worldwide.
